The baguette de pain, commonly known as a French baguette, is a classic staple of French cuisine and has origins dating back to the early 18th century. Known for its crisp crust and soft, airy interior, this long, thin loaf of bread is made primarily from wheat flour, water, salt, and yeast. Typically low in fat, it is a carbohydrate-rich food, providing approximately 270 calories, 57g of carbohydrates, 1g of fat, and 9g of protein per 100g serving. It lacks significant micronutrients but offers small amounts of iron, B vitamins, and magnesium.

Traditional baguette de pain is not particularly high in protein. One serving (about 50 grams, approximately 1/4 of a standard baguette) contains around 3-4 grams of protein. While it does provide some protein, it is primarily a source of carbohydrates.
Baguette de pain is not suitable for a keto diet as it is high in carbohydrates. A standard serving of 50 grams can contain approximately 26-28 grams of carbs, which exceeds the typical daily carb allowance for most keto plans.
Baguette de pain can provide quick energy due to its carbohydrate content, making it a good option for active individuals. However, it is low in fiber and nutrients compared to whole-grain alternatives and may cause blood sugar spikes if consumed excessively, especially for individuals managing diabetes.
A typical serving size is about 50 grams or 1/4 of a standard baguette. This portion contains approximately 130-140 calories, making it an appropriate amount to enjoy as part of a balanced meal. Pair it with protein and vegetables for a more nutritionally complete plate.
Baguette de pain is lower in fiber and essential nutrients compared to whole-grain bread. While baguettes are mostly made from refined white flour, which lacks fiber, whole-grain bread can support digestion and provide higher levels of vitamins like B vitamins and minerals such as magnesium. If seeking a more nutrient-dense option, whole-grain bread is preferable.
